Calliarthron is a genus containing two species of thalloid intertidal[1] alga. Specimens can reach around 30 cm in size. The thalli take a crustose form. The organisms lack secondary pit connections. Calliarthron reproduces by means of conceptacles; it produces tetraspores, dispores and carpospores. The genus has lignin and contains secondary cell walls, traits which are normally associated with the vascular plants.[1] It is similar to the genus Bossiella.[2]

Calliarthron is calcified, but also has uncalcified joints that allow it to flex in response to the waves to which it is subjected.[1] These joints start out calcified, and decalcify as they grow older.[1] After decalcifying they grow much longer, then fatten themselves up in the same way as xylem formation, resulting in secondary walls.[1]
